Title: Suyeon Han: Innovator in Power Amplifier Systems

Introduction

Suyeon Han is a notable inventor based in Suwon-si, South Korea. He has made significant contributions to the field of power amplifier systems, holding a total of 3 patents. His work is characterized by innovative designs that enhance the performance of RF input signals.

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is a power amplifier system that includes a drive stage designed to amplify an RF input signal, implemented in a substrate containing silicon. This system also features a power stage with a carrier amplifier and a peaking amplifier, both of which are implemented in a substrate containing gallium arsenide. Additionally, it incorporates a phase compensation circuit that alters the phase of the RF input signal, connecting either the carrier amplifier or the peaking amplifier to this circuit.

Another recent patent describes a power amplifier system that consists of a base substrate and a driver stage. The driver stage receives and amplifies an RF input signal and is located within the base substrate, while the power stage, which amplifies the RF input signal further, is situated outside the base substrate and is implemented in a second substrate that is independent of the first.
